Description

Beige to golden body with black mane, tail, and lower legs. Results from one Cream gene copy on a bay base. Similar to palomino but retaining the black points.

Visual traits

Beige-golden body · Black mane, tail, and lower legs · Brown eyes

Genetic basis

Extension E/-, Agouti A/-, Cream nCr — Cream dilution applied to a bay base.

The Dun gene dilutes the base coat and adds primitive wild-horse markings: a dorsal stripe along the spine, leg barring, and sometimes shoulder stripes.

The Frame Overo pattern adds irregular white patches to the base coat. Crossing two Frame horses is dangerous: 25% of foals will be homozygous O/O (OLWS) and will not survive.
